1.500 Surround Sound: Before 5.1 surround sound, there was stereo. Long before both, there was the original surround sound: the grand polychoral style of the 1500s. Les Canards Chantants invites the listener to occupy the acoustical architecture of lavish works by Victoria, Lassus, Gabrieli and more, in a program that exploits the drama of sound and space.
We will also have baritone Jamal Sarikoki who has come back from Colorado to perform with us. It is his birthday weekend and he will be sharing four of his favorite spirituals as an extended encore for us.

Les Canards Chantants (The Singing Ducks) are specialists in the music of the Renaissance and making Renaissance approachable for modern day audiences.
